**Vendor note: Inkmill markdown pipeline**

Rendering for Parchway docs is outsourced to Inkmill under an annual contract, renewing each March. They handle sanitization and PDF export; we own the upload queue. SLA: 4-hour response on rendering failures. Escalate only after two failed retries. Their support desk is reachable at the address below.

billing contact of hahaf-baguf = zorael.tammir.jorius@sivrelhq.internal

## Notification Fan-out — Backpressure Basics

When the Plover notification service falls behind, it applies backpressure by pausing low-priority fan-out rather than dropping messages, so customers may see digest emails arrive late during spikes. Support can confirm a backpressure event from the Relaywatch status panel before filing an incident. Reading queue depths from Relaywatch requires authenticated access to the metrics service, which all support shift leads share. That service's key is below.

app token of yajof-fajof = zpat11_OrsDd3gqCaG

## Ownership

The ParcelPing webhook service is maintained by the Dispatch Integrations group at Corvane Logistics. All changes to retry logic, signature verification, or delivery-status payloads require review from the service owner before merge. Please do not modify the dead-letter queue configuration without prior approval, as downstream partners depend on its exact behavior. For any questions, escalations, or access requests, contact the current owner directly.

named custodian: Oliath Ralax